The Minister of Youth and Sports, Abderrazak Sebgag, is confident of seeing Algeria host CAN-2025, given the major sports infrastructure our country has. Only, he demands from CAF more transparency in the choice of the country which will host the 35th edition of the CAN.

As everyone knows, Algeria has officially applied to host CAN-2025. The Algerian Football Federation submitted the application file on December 16, at CAF headquarters in Cairo, Egypt.

In addition to Algeria, Nigeria, together with Benin, Zambia, Morocco and finally South Africa have also applied to host the 35th edition of the CAN. The least we can say is that our country will have serious competitors. While Morocco and South Africa are not to be presented, the other candidate countries have experienced proven progress in terms of infrastructure.

If Algeria could get ahead of its competitors, it is obviously thanks to CHAN-2022 which is taking place in our country. Indeed, the tournament continues in very good conditions. The new sports infrastructure and the good organization impressed everyone present, including the president of CAF, Patrice Motsepe.

Sebgag confident for CAN-2025?

But the Minister of Youth and Sports, Abderrazak Sebgag, is confident about Algeria’s candidacy file. The reason is simple, our country has all the means to host a continental competition.

“We have filed a solid case. Algeria is a country that has always given a good example of peace. All African countries have recognized it, in fact… I think that Algeria has all the means to host CAN-2025. We gave all our guarantees, now the ball is in the court of the Confederation of African Football. He will say, in a statement granted to the Algerian media.

The first manager of the sports sector in Algeria demands from the first instance of African football more transparency in the choice of the host country. “Only CAF must guarantee that the process of choosing the country that will host the 35th edition of the CAN is done transparently. Now if there is another candidate country that has better infrastructure than Algeria, we will applaud it in advance”. He added.
